Nokia X100 has an overall score of 77.3, which is a little bit better than LG G5's general score of 76.1. Although Nokia X100 is newer than LG G5, it's somewhat thicker and noticeably heavier. Both of these phones work with Android OS, but the Nokia X100 has an older 11 version and LG G5 has Android 8.0 Oreo version.
LG G5 has a little sharper screen than Nokia X100, because although it has a really smaller screen, it also counts with a better pixels quantity in each inch of screen and a higher 1440 x 2560 resolution. Nokia X100 has a little faster processing unit than LG G5, because it has 4 more cores and 2 GB more RAM.
LG G5 takes much better photographs and videos than Nokia X100, although it has a way worse resolution back-facing camera. The Nokia X100 features a lot bigger storage to install applications and games than LG G5, because although it has a slot for an SD memory card that allows a maximum of 1 TB against 1,95 TB, it also counts with 96 GB more internal storage.
The Nokia X100 counts with a much longer battery life than LG G5, because it has a 4470mAh battery capacity.
